    We are from N. AL, and were visiting in ********** when the motorcycle that we were traveling on would not crank. We had stopped in at Busa Bikes to get a tire and rim installed on our bike a few days earlier, so we decided to have the bike towed one block to Busa Bikes on Friday, August 18th. We were told the following week that the motorcycle needed a new wiring harness. After 2 weeks of staying in a hotel with no transportation, we reluctantly had a ride come pick us up, and went back to North Alabama without our bike. I have mechanical experience and am completely aware that it should not have taken two weeks to replace a wiring harness. But I gave the benefit of the doubt to the mechanic who explained they had to order a new wiring harness, and he had other bikes ahead of mine to be worked on. After repeatedly calling to no answer, I was finally able to speak to the mechanic the end of September who told me that my timing chain is stretched. For starters, the wiring harness has nothing to do with a timing chain. Secondly, a timing chain does NOT stretch. When I started to speak on this with the mechanic, and he realized I was knowledgeable, he began to get an attitude with me and told me that I needed to get a new timing chain that I didn't know what I was talking about. I have tried to get in contact with them again almost everyday. They must screen their phone calls because they are not answering mine at all. Having told them that I am not financially well off, and them knowing that I live out of town, I am scared that this company is trying to run my bill up so high that I cannot afford it. Therefore, they will put a lien on my title to my bike, and if I cannot pay the bill that I feel like is illegally being hiked up, then they will receive ownership of my motorcycle. I did not read reviews on this company until after they were not answering my phone calls. It seems that customer service and shady business is a recurring problem with this company.
